我们有一个 Seaside 应用程序可以创建 session 并处理用户登录等。所以我们对此很满意。
但是我们希望能够使用固定的 url 来提供一些页面。这不是使用#initialRequest: 并根据 url 委托(delegate)给某个组件的问题。然而,我想避免的是,其中一些页面会创建一个新 session 并启动所有随之而来的机器。
有什么想法吗?
最佳答案
海边2
您可以创建一个 WASession
(或 WAMain
)子类,如果请求是静态的,它将被使用。然后在该 session (或主 session )中,您可以覆盖那些根据您的喜好做太多事情的方法。
海边3
您可以使用新的 filter mechanism .如果我没记错的话,您几乎可以随时控制请求。这应该会给你足够的影响力来做你想做的事。
关于smalltalk - 在不创建 session 的情况下提供海边页面/组件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21723325/